Namiko Sakurai is a scholar working on Global and Planetary Change, Atmospheric Science and Oceanography. According to data from OpenAlex, Namiko Sakurai has authored 19 papers receiving a total of 540 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Global and Planetary Change, 12 papers in Atmospheric Science and 5 papers in Oceanography. Recurrent topics in Namiko Sakurai’s work include Climate variability and models (10 papers), Meteorological Phenomena and Simulations (9 papers) and Tropical and Extratropical Cyclones Research (6 papers). Namiko Sakurai is often cited by papers focused on Climate variability and models (10 papers), Meteorological Phenomena and Simulations (9 papers) and Tropical and Extratropical Cyclones Research (6 papers). Namiko Sakurai collaborates with scholars based in Japan, Indonesia and United States. Namiko Sakurai's co-authors include Shuichi Mori, Manabu D. Yamanaka, Takeshi Maesaka, Jun-ichi Hamada and Shingo Shimizu and has published in prestigious journals such as Monthly Weather Review, Quarterly Journal of the Royal Meteorological Society and Journal of the Meteorological Society of Japan Ser II.
